Extending Life Expectancy through Medical Innovation

In the early 20th century, life expectancy was significantly lower than it is today, largely due to the lack of effective treatments for common diseases such as tuberculosis, cholera, and pneumonia. However, the advent of antibiotics like penicillin, antivirals, and vaccines has transformed the healthcare landscape. Today, drugs targeting chronic conditions like hypertension, diabetes, and cancer have pushed life expectancy even further, enabling many people to live long and fulfilling lives despite serious health issues.

One of the most remarkable areas of progress is in the field of oncology. Cancer, once considered an incurable death sentence, can now often be treated effectively with targeted therapies, immunotherapies, and chemotherapy. Many life-saving cancer drugs enable patients to manage their conditions over the long term, helping them to lead relatively normal lives. Gefitinib, for instance, is a revolutionary drug used to treat non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). By targeting specific molecular changes in cancer cells, drugs like Gefitinib block the growth and spread of tumors, offering patients not just more time, but a better quality of life during treatment.

Transforming Chronic Disease Management

In addition to tackling life-threatening conditions like cancer, life-saving drugs have revolutionized the management of chronic diseases, which are a major cause of mortality globally. Conditions such as cardiovascular diseases, diabetes, and chronic respiratory diseases can now be managed with an array of pharmaceutical interventions, ensuring that patients can live long, productive lives despite their diagnoses.

For instance, antihypertensive drugs help control blood pressure, reducing the risk of stroke and heart attacks, while insulin therapies manage diabetes, preventing life-threatening complications. In many cases, early intervention with life-saving drugs can prevent disease progression and complications, helping individuals avoid hospitalization and maintain an active lifestyle.

The development of antiretroviral therapies (ART) for HIV is another notable success story. In the early stages of the HIV/AIDS epidemic, a diagnosis was almost certainly a death sentence. However, ART has turned HIV into a chronic but manageable condition, allowing millions of people around the world to live long and relatively healthy lives.

Impact on Rare and Genetic Disorders

Beyond common diseases, life-saving drugs have also made a profound impact on rare and genetic disorders. Treatments for conditions like cystic fibrosis, hemophilia, and muscular dystrophy, once considered untreatable, are now available, often thanks to breakthroughs in biotechnology. Gene therapy and biologic drugs are changing the way these diseases are managed, offering patients the chance at a normal life where none existed before.

Take, for example, enzyme replacement therapies for conditions like Gaucher’s disease or Pompe disease. These therapies directly address the underlying genetic deficiencies, slowing or even halting disease progression. This means that individuals who would otherwise have faced severe disability or early death can now look forward to longer, healthier lives.

Challenges and Future Prospects

Despite the remarkable benefits of life-saving drugs, challenges remain in ensuring equitable access. High costs, regulatory hurdles, and limited healthcare infrastructure in certain regions can impede the widespread availability of these medications. To address these challenges, international collaborations, government initiatives, and partnerships between private and public sectors are essential.

Moreover, ongoing research into personalized medicine is expected to further improve treatment outcomes. As we better understand the genetic and molecular basis of diseases, future drugs will likely become more targeted and effective, with fewer side effects. This is particularly promising in areas like oncology, where precision medicine is already showing great potential.
